MySQL备份恢复技术:深度解析与实战案例

AI绘图结果,仅供参考

MySQL备份恢复技术是数据库管理中的重要环节,确保数据在意外丢失或损坏时能够快速恢复。常见的备份方式包括物理备份和逻辑备份,每种方法都有其适用场景。

物理备份直接复制数据库文件,如使用XtraBackup工具,适合大型数据库,恢复速度快,但需要停机或锁表操作,可能影响业务运行。

逻辑备份通过SQL语句导出数据,例如使用mysqldump命令,适用于小型数据库或需要灵活恢复的场景。这种备份方式对系统资源消耗较小,但恢复时间较长。

在实际应用中,建议结合多种备份策略,形成完整的备份体系。例如,定期进行全量备份,并配合增量备份,减少数据丢失风险。

恢复过程需根据备份类型选择合适的方法。物理备份恢复通常涉及替换数据目录,而逻辑备份则需执行SQL脚本。恢复前应确保目标环境与原环境兼容。

除了备份和恢复,还应定期测试恢复流程,验证备份的有效性。避免因备份文件损坏或配置错误导致恢复失败。

实战案例中,某电商平台因误删数据,通过最近一次逻辑备份成功恢复了关键业务数据,避免了重大损失。这说明备份策略的有效性和及时性至关重要。

dawei

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注